Materials Handler - Acquisition Support
New Yesterday
Become an essential member of our team, contributing to the processing of buyout merchandise from delivery to final handling. We are looking for someone who can facilitate clear communication between departments concerning acquisitions and engage in travel opportunities related to various projects.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
Travel as needed to support acquisition projects.
Receive inbound shipments and prepare outbound supplies efficiently.
Utilize the buyout sorting process to determine the appropriate disposition of merchandise.
Effectively accumulate and stage buyout supplies.
Process buyout merchandise that requires reboxing or relabeling and assist vendor representatives with their responsibilities.
Manage merchandise inventory accurately using the buyout scanning process.
Maintain strong communication with management and vendors to ensure smooth operations.
Adhere to safety protocols while identifying and reporting unsafe practices or situations.
Provide training for new team members, ensuring thorough instruction and proper documentation.
Perform additional tasks as assigned to support team goals.
SKILLS/E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E
Required:
Basic computer skills.
Able to multitask and work effectively within a team.
Proficient in reading and matching numerical and alphabetical characters quickly and accurately.
Willingness to travel as required for projects.
Desired:
High school diploma or equivalent (GED).
Advanced computer skills.
Previous experience or knowledge of automotive products.
Fluency in multiple languages (Spanish preferred).
